The MSD rev limiter works by dropping spark to selected cylinders. It doesn't actually drop power to the distributor, it just kinda "loses" the signal to fire, but it still sends out the proper tach output.
Jeff, the L98 ECM cuts fuel when you reach the programmed RPM, and then turns ie back on at another set variable.
The MSD boxes have a "soft touch" limiter like Nathan said. It will drop spark (not fuel) to selected cylinders and then alternate them. So your normal firing order of 18436572, might turn into something like 1467...8352...1467....8352. Much much much nicer on the engine components.
